Über mich
As an experienced statistics and programming tutor, I am passionate about empowering students to conquer their statistical challenges with ease. With 15 years of dedicated tutoring and teaching experience and engineer training in statistics at ENSAE ParisTech, I bring a wealth of knowledge and expertise to every session. My patient and personalized approach ensures a safe and supportive learning environment where you can thrive.

Goodwill is my watchword: please never feel ashamed to ask a "stupid" question! (spoiler alert: they don't exist)

Having had the privilege of tutoring students from diverse backgrounds across multiple countries such as Ireland, France, the UK, and more, I bring a truly global perspective to my tutoring. My international experience at university and as an independent tutor has allowed me to work with students pursuing various majors, including psychology, political science, biology, digital humanities, and even paleontology! This exposure to a wide range of disciplines has enriched my teaching approach, enabling me to tailor my instruction to meet your specific needs and goals. Regardless of your field of study, I am well-equipped to guide you through the intricacies of statistics and programming, ensuring your success in any academic context.

My teaching method is rooted in the understanding that mathematics plays a crucial role in everyone's lives, whether in the short run, such as passing an exam or incorporating statistical analysis into a thesis, or in the long run, where the ability to calculate, use, and interpret numbers is essential for informed decision-making.

Most importantly, I have observed that the majority of my students (and there are more than a hundred of them to this day, most of them with 'non-scientific' backgrounds) struggle with self-confidence and mistakenly believe that mathematics and numbers "aren't meant for them".

I firmly believe that self-confidence is the cornerstone of success in mathematics and statistics, and it is not a matter of inherent abilities but rather a question of adopting the right methodology.

Learning your lessons is one thing. Another is to develop problem-solving strategies, generate ideas, and effectively tackle exercises. That's why my guidance focuses on two pillars:

- Practice is key: even simple problems can be difficult to solve if you lack practice. Together we will focus on how to solve exercises but also (and above all!) how to sharpen practical reflexes that you can apply in your exams or tests.

- A method is essential: knowing how to read a statement properly, having ideas for starting exercises, and not panicking when you get stuck on a question. These are things we are rarely taught in a standard class. And in this respect, every student is unique! Finding the method that suits you will make you realize that you have the maths skills you need: all you have to do is let me help you to unlock them.
Bildung
I hold a Bachelor's degree from the Toulouse School of Economics, where I gained a solid foundation in the fields of statistics, economics, and mathematics.
In parallel, I undertook training in the advanced study program 'Magistère d'économiste statisticien' in partnership with the Université Paul Sabatier in Toulouse. This comprehensive program exposed me to a wide range of topics in probability, statistical methodology, and programming.
Building upon this, I pursued further education with intensive engineer training at ENSAE ParisTech, honing my skills in statistical analysis and programming.
Additionally, during a gap year in my studies, I had the opportunity to work as a researcher at renowned universities, including the University College Dublin (UCD) and the University of Bristol. This invaluable experience expanded my knowledge and provided me with a global perspective in statistics and data analysis.
